Understanding the $5000 Bathroom Budget
When thinking about updating your bathroom for $5000, it’s important to break down where the money will go. Here’s a general idea of how you might allocate your budget:
Expense | Approximate Cost |
Fixtures (toilet, sink, showerhead) | $500 – $1000 |
Flooring | $300 – $600 |
Paint & Wall Repair | $100 – $300 |
Vanity & Storage | $300 – $800 |
Labor | $1500 – $2500 |
Miscellaneous | $200 – $400 |
Note: These are estimated ranges and can vary depending on materials and labor costs in Lawrenceville.
Setting Priorities for Maximum Impact
With a limited budget, you must focus on areas that provide the most noticeable improvements:
1. Paint and Wall Treatments
A fresh coat of paint is one of the most affordable yet transformative ways to update a bathroom. Opt for light, neutral colors to make the space feel larger and more modern.
2. Update Fixtures
Replacing outdated faucets, showerheads, and cabinet handles can modernize the look of your bathroom without heavy construction. Brushed nickel or matte black finishes are currently trending and affordable.
3. Refinish Instead of Replace
If your bathtub or sink is structurally sound but stained or outdated, consider refinishing. It’s far cheaper than replacement and can give a like-new appearance.
4. Choose Budget-Friendly Flooring
Vinyl and laminate flooring options have come a long way. These materials mimic the look of more expensive tile or wood and are moisture-resistant—perfect for bathrooms.
5. Keep Plumbing in Place
The cost to move plumbing can eat up a budget fast. By keeping the layout of your sink, toilet, and shower the same, you save thousands in labor and materials.
Tips for Staying Within Budget
Shop at Discount Stores
Use home improvement outlets or clearance sections for deals on vanities, tiles, and fixtures.
Reuse and Repurpose
If existing cabinetry is in good condition, consider repainting or replacing just the doors and handles.
DIY Where Possible
Tasks like painting, installing shelves, or changing hardware can be done by most homeowners.

Realistic Expectations vs. Dream Bathrooms
It’s important to manage your expectations. A $5000 budget will likely not cover luxury finishes or full layout changes, but it can still result in a stylish, functional space. Focus on:
- Clean lines
- Efficient lighting
- Simple but elegant fixtures
With creative thinking and cost-effective choices, your bathroom can still feel like a mini spa retreat.
Examples of What You Can Get for $5000
Example 1: Basic Makeover
- New paint
- New toilet and vanity
- Refinished bathtub
- Updated fixtures
- Vinyl plank flooring
Example 2: Cosmetic Focus
- Designer lighting
- Floating shelves for storage
- Stylish but affordable vanity
- Decorative mirror
- Waterproof laminate flooring
Example 3: Functional Overhaul
- New toilet
- Walk-in shower conversion (prefab)
- Basic ceramic tile floor
- Budget sink and faucet
- Light fixture upgrade

2. What’s the most expensive part of bathroom remodelling?
Labor and moving plumbing are usually the most expensive components. You can save a lot by keeping the plumbing layout the same.

5. Can I install a new shower on a $5000 budget?
Yes, if you opt for a prefabricated shower kit and avoid custom tiling or plumbing changes.
6. Are there financing options for bathroom remodeling?
Many contractors and home improvement stores offer low-interest financing or payment plans, even for smaller projects.
7. How long does a budget bathroom remodel take?
Most $5000 bathroom updates can be completed in 1-2 weeks, depending on the project scope and material availability.
8. Should I replace or refinish my bathtub?
Refinishing is much cheaper and can give your bathtub a fresh, modern look at a fraction of the cost.
9. What’s the best flooring for a budget bathroom remodel?
Vinyl plank or sheet vinyl are durable, water-resistant, and affordable, making them ideal choices for budget projects.
